Transaction 59398ca9561b26ad00610a04adaad0133e26c88034a2eab36455631e7f1f680d
1 Input
1 Output
-
59398ca9561b26ad00610a04adaad0133e26c88034a2eab36455631e7f1f680d:0
- value
- 616519
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f881956b436126415fcd041db1e78df6db27efe0 OP_EQUAL
- address
- 3QLzjkPBv1tNphcH5YLu5UsvMuRB6i8jbP